    On Wed, 2004-04-07 at 14:24, Matthew Dobson wrote:
    > Andi,
    > I must be missing something here, but did you not include mempolicy.h
    > and policy.c in these patches? I can't seem to find them anywhere?!?
    > It's really hard to evaluate your patches if the core of them is
    > missing!

    Running make -j24 bzImage
    In file included from arch/i386/kernel/asm-offsets.c:7:
    include/linux/sched.h:32: linux/mempolicy.h: No such file or directory
    make[1]: *** [arch/i386/kernel/asm-offsets.s] Error 1
    make: *** [arch/i386/kernel/asm-offsets.s] Error 2

    I'm guessing you just forgot the -N option to diff. You might want to
    add the -p option when you rediff and repost because it makes your
    patches an order of magnitude easier to read when you can tell what
    function the patch is modifying.
